As the world continues to battle the deadly COVID-19 pandemic, various artistes are coming out to help vulnerable and less fortunate members of the society in one way or another.

Over the past few months, thousands of people have had to take pay cuts, others have lost their jobs due to measures put in place by various governments, in a bid to combat spread of the disease.

In Tanzania, renowned musician Diamond Platnumz has offered to pay rent for at least 500 families facing hard times due to the virus.

“Najua katika kipindi hiki cha Corona, mambo mengi hayajakaa sawa, hususan upande wa biashara....nyingi zimeshuka na kupelekea hali ya kifedha kuyumba na mambo kuwa kidogo Magumu kwa wengi wetu...ijapokuwa na mimi ni Miongoni mwa walio ndani ya janga hili, lakini nimeona walau kwa kidogo changu nilicho nacho, nitoe kusaidia kulipia kodi za Nyumba kwa miezi Mitatu mitatu kwa familia 500, walau kusaidiana Katika kipindi hiki kigumu cha kupambana na Virusi hivi vya Corona...Licha ya kuwa Tiafa moja lakini siku zote mmekuwa Familia yangu kupitia Muziki wangu, hivyo naamini Shida yenu ni yangu, na Tabasamu lenu ni Langu pia....Jumatatu nitaweka rasmi Utaratibu wote wa namna gani Familia Hizi Miatano zinaweza kupata kodi hizo ya Nyumba...” Diamond’s message read in part.

A couple of weeks ago, Daimond’s Wasafi records was hit by the virus, forcing the entire crew to go into quarantine with Diamond’s manager Sallam SK and producer Ayo Lizer testing positive for COVID-19.
